About Göran Andersson
Göran Andersson is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Surgery and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, having authored 69 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Bone Metabolism and Diseases (34 papers), Bone health and treatments (18 papers), Bone health and osteoporosis research (10 papers), Bone and Dental Protein Studies (9 papers), Growth Hormone and Insulin-like Growth Factors (7 papers), Alkaline Phosphatase Research Studies (7 papers), Pancreatic function and diabetes (6 papers) and Trace Elements in Health (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(322 citations), Oncology (614 citations), Nephrology (161 citations), Rheumatology (305 citations) and Molecular Biology (1.2k citations). Göran Andersson has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, United States and Finland. Frequent co-authors include Barbro Ek‐Rylander, Maria Norgård, Karin Hollberg, Finn P. Reinholt, Pernilla Lång, Jan-Ακε Gustafsson, Kjell Hultenby, Sara H. Windahl, Claes Ohlsson and Yunling Wang. Their work appears in journals such as Bone, Calcified Tissue International, Journal of Bone and Mineral Research,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ications and Journal of Biological Chemistry.
